In the Matter of
PREMCOR REFINING GROUP, INC.
Respondent
CPF No. 2-2004-6012
FINAL ORDER
On Apri121 and 22, 2004 pursuant to 49 U S. C. II 60117, representatives of the Central and Southern
Regions, Office of Pipeline Safety (OPS), conducted an inspection of Respondent's Operator
Qualification Plan at it's Memphis, Tennessee Truck Terminal. As a result of this investigation, the
Director, Southern Region, OPS, issued to Respondent, by letter dated September 22, 2004, a Notice
of Probable Violation and Proposed Compliance Order (Notice). In accordance with 49 C. F. R.
I) 190, 207, the Notice proposed finding that Respondent had violated 49 C, F. R. t) 195. 505 and
proposed that Respondent take certain measures to correct the alleged violations. '
Respondent responded to the Notice by letter dated, October 18, 2004 (Response). Respondent did
not contest the allegation of violation but provided information concerning the corrective actions it
has taken. Respondent did not request a hearing, and therefore has waived its right to one.
FINDINGS OF VIOLATION
In its Response, Respondent did not contest the alleged violation of 49 C. F. R. II 195. 505 in the
Notice. Accordingly, 1 find that Respondent violated 49 C. F. R. Part 195, as more fully described
in the Notice:
49 C. F. R. II 195. 505(a) and (c) — failing to adequately prepare and follow a written
qualification program, as Respondent failed to include provisions to define the
number of persons, and under what conditions, a qualified person can direct and
observe non-qualified persons. Also, Respondent failed to include "excavation" as
a covered tasks.

This finding of violation will be considered a prior offense in any subsequent enforcement action
taken against Respondent.
COMPLIANCE ORDER
The Notice proposed a compliance order with respect to Item 1 for violation of 49 C. F. R.
t'l 195. 505(a) and 0). Under 49 U. S. C. t'l 60118(a), each person who engages in the transportatioii
of hazardous liquids or who owns or operates a pipeline facility is required to comply with the
applicable safety standards established under chapter 601. The Regional Director has indicated that
Respondent has taken the following actions specified in the proposed compliance order:
Respondent has revised it's Operator Qualification Plan (OQ) to include provisions
to define the number of persons, and under what conditions, a qualified person can
direct and observe non-qualified persons. The task "excavation" has been added to
the covered tasks list. Respondent also added to it's OQ plan the requirement that
welding can not be done by a non-qualified person under the direction and
observation of a qualified person.
Accordingly, since compliance has been achieved with respect to this violation, the compliance
terms are not included in this Order.
